17:40Now PlayingGeorgia’s special legislative session ended this week without action on redrawing congressional and legislative maps, leaving unresolved political pressure inside the Republican Party and setting up a renewed fight ahead of the 2028 cycle.
Lieutenant Gov. Burt Jones signaled frustration with delaying redistricting, warning that postponing could bring political consequences for lawmakers as national Republicans push states to revisit district lines. Rick Folbaum and Doug Reardon talk about the latest developments.
